## Changelog — Veristack 3.2.0: Changed defaults

The validator plugin system now loads third-party plugins in sandboxed mode by default, and unsigned plugins are rejected rather than warned about. This reverses the permissive 3.1 behavior that allowed silent schema overrides. Reviewers should confirm no internal plugins rely on the old loading order. The shipped defaults for the plugin loader are as follows.

service settings:
druael:
  pin: 7528
  metrics_host: metrics.druael.lumiclabs.internal
  tenant: wendor
  seal: seal_c765840a

Known issue: the Glimmerfeed image cache leaks memory when thumbnails exceed 4MB. Symptoms: RSS climbs steadily, OOM kill around hour six. Mitigation: restart the cache pod; fix is tracked for the next release. On-call: check the Vantry metrics dashboard first, confirm heap growth, then restart. Do not flush the cache store, it repopulates slowly. To query Vantry metrics from the CLI you need the internal metrics key, which is below.

service key, bajog-yahop: kto7_mMHVCpJ

Onboarding note for reception staff: the Larkfell support team works overnight and arrives between 21:30 and 22:30. They enter via the east lobby, not the main doors. Check each person against the support roster and issue an overnight lanyard. If the east lobby reader is down, let them through manually using the override code below.

badge for haduf-bafop: bdg-O-78

Subject: Rotated key — Eventloom schema registry

Heads up: the service key for the internal Eventloom schema registry was rotated today as part of the quarterly cycle. The old key is revoked effective immediately, so any open PRs touching registry clients should be updated before merge. Please check that the reviewed branches read the key from config rather than hardcoding it; two did last quarter. For reference during review, the new key follows.

gateway credential: kto3_qfe

Break-glass access — Fenholt websocket gateway. Use only when the reconnect bug (clients looping on handshake) takes down live sessions and normal auth is unavailable. Grab the emergency console from the Fenholt admin panel, restart the gateway pair, confirm reconnect counts drop. Access requires the break-glass passphrase, appended below.

strongbox words: fraath-isteth